Where to Use With Caution
There are a few scenarios where the Eat Sleep Play Guitar Repeat Music Shirt might not perform as expected. Small hoop sizes could limit your ability to stitch the full design without breaking it into sections. Textured fabrics or thin materials might make the design appear less crisp, especially if the stabilizer isn’t properly applied.
On dark fabrics, the design’s contrast might be an issue unless you choose the right thread colors. Similarly, stretchy or curved surfaces like caps can challenge the integrity of the stitches, particularly around the edges of the guitar graphic. If you’re planning to use this on a product that will see frequent washing, make sure the stitching is dense enough to withstand wear and tear.

Practical Designer Notes
Before committing to a project, test the Eat Sleep Play Guitar Repeat Music Shirt on scrap fabric. This will help you assess how the design translates to different materials and stitch types. Pay close attention to thread color contrast, especially if you’re using it on dark or light backgrounds.
Review the stitch density to ensure it’s appropriate for the fabric you’re using. If the design is too dense, it might cause puckering or stiffness. Check the hoop size requirements to make sure your machine can handle the design without complications. Also, inspect small details like the corners of the guitar and the spacing between the repeated phrases.
Use black and white mockups to see how the design looks without color. This can help you identify any issues with line weight or spacing. Finally, confirm whether the design is suitable for both personal and commercial projects, and always check the licensing terms before selling finished items or digital products.
